#372d83 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#372d83 is composed of 21.6% red, 17.6%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58% cyan, 65.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 247 degrees, a saturation of 48.9% and a lightness of 34.5%. #372d83 color hex could be obtained by blending #6e5aff with #000007.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

● #372d83 color description : Dark moderate blue.
#372d83 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#372d83 has RGB values of R:55, G:45, B:131 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0.66,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 3616131.
